3-Ingredient Banana Pancakes
Hop to it: Whip up cute and tasty hotcakes quick as you-know-what

Yields:
4
About 200 cals, 8 g protein, 33 g carbs, 4 g fat (2 g sat), 2 g fiber, 335 mg sodium

Ingredients
- 2 very ripe lg. bananas
- 3 large eggs
- 3/4 cup self-rising flour
TOPPINGS:
- Whipped cream for garnish
- Shredded coconut for tail
- Banana slices for feet
- Mini chocolate chips for feet
Directions
- Step 1In blender, puree bananas until smooth. Add eggs; pulse until combined. Pulse in flour until just incorporated.
- Step 2Lightly grease griddle or nonstick 12-inch skillet; heat on medium 1 minute.
- Step 3Drop batter onto hot griddle as directed below. Cook pancakes 2 to 3 minutes or until bubbles start to form and edges look dry. With spatula, turn; cook 1 to 2 minutes more until puffy and underside is golden brown (keep warm on cookie sheet in 225 degree F oven).
- Step 4For each bunny: Drop 1/4 cup batter for body, 2 tablespoons batter for head, 1 tablespoon batter in oval shape for each foot and 1 tablespoon batter in elongated shape for each ear. Arrange on plate.
- Step 5Garnish with whipped cream and shredded coconut for tail and banana slices and mini chocolate chips for feet.
